1. Which two opposing cosmic forces did Empedocles believe drove the cyclical combination and separation of elements?

Explanation

Empedocles proposed that the universe is governed by two fundamental forces: Love, which brings elements together and fosters unity, and Strife, which causes separation and division. This duality reflects his belief in a cyclical process where these forces interact to create and dissolve the world around us. Love represents harmony and attraction, while Strife symbolizes conflict and repulsion, illustrating the balance of creation and destruction in nature. This concept laid the groundwork for later philosophical and scientific explorations of dualistic forces in the cosmos.

2. Which of the following are features of Ancient Indian city planning?

Explanation

Ancient Indian city planning, particularly in the Indus Valley Civilization, showcased remarkable advancements. Uniform baked-brick dwellings allowed for durable and standardized construction. Grid-like street patterns facilitated organized movement and efficient land use. Advanced drainage and sanitation systems demonstrate a sophisticated understanding of hygiene and urban infrastructure, ensuring the health and well-being of residents. In contrast, circular amphitheaters were not a characteristic feature of these ancient cities, highlighting the distinct urban design principles of the time.

6. Pythagoras was the first person to ever use the concept of the Pythagorean theorem.

Explanation

While Pythagoras is often credited with formalizing the Pythagorean theorem, the concept itself predates him. Ancient civilizations, such as the Babylonians and Indians, had knowledge of the relationship between the sides of right triangles long before Pythagoras. They used geometric principles that align with the theorem, indicating that the understanding of these mathematical relationships existed earlier and was not solely attributed to Pythagoras.

11. What two writing systems did the ancient Egyptians develop?

Explanation

Ancient Egyptians developed two primary writing systems: Hieroglyphics and Hieratic. Hieroglyphics, known for its intricate symbols, was used for formal inscriptions and religious texts, often carved on monuments and tombs. Hieratic, a simplified cursive form of Hieroglyphics, was employed for everyday writing on papyrus and in administrative documents. This distinction allowed for efficient communication while preserving the sacred nature of Hieroglyphics in ceremonial contexts. Together, these systems reflect the complexity and richness of ancient Egyptian culture and its approach to writing.

15. According to Thales, what is the fundamental substance of the universe?

Explanation

Thales, a pre-Socratic philosopher, proposed that water is the fundamental substance of the universe, believing it to be the source of all things. He observed that water is essential for life and exists in various forms—liquid, solid (ice), and gas (steam)—which reflects its transformative nature. Thales' emphasis on water highlights his view that a single underlying element could explain the diversity of the natural world, making it a foundational concept in early philosophical thought.

16. What advanced public health systems were found in Ancient Indian cities?

Explanation

Ancient Indian cities, particularly during the Indus Valley Civilization, showcased remarkable public health systems. They featured indoor toilets connected to a sophisticated network of covered sewage channels, demonstrating advanced sanitation practices. This infrastructure allowed for the efficient removal of waste, significantly reducing the risk of waterborne diseases. The emphasis on hygiene and public health in these urban centers highlights the ingenuity and foresight of ancient Indian society in addressing sanitation and health needs.

19. Ancient India's urban civilization dates back to approximately ______ BCE.

Explanation

Ancient India's urban civilization, particularly the Indus Valley Civilization, emerged around 3300 BCE. This period marked the development of advanced urban centers like Harappa and Mohenjo-Daro, characterized by sophisticated architecture, urban planning, and trade systems. The civilization is notable for its writing system, metallurgy, and agricultural practices, reflecting a high degree of social organization and cultural development. The dating to 3300 BCE highlights the early onset of urban life in the Indian subcontinent, positioning it among the world's earliest civilizations.
